## Pinebook function keys |
|
|
|
The sleep (Fn+Esc), home (Fn+F1), volume down (Fn+F3), volume up (Fn+F4), and mute (Fn+F5) keys on the keyboard are mapped to uhid(4) devices. |
|
|
|
Create the following config file: |
|
|
|
[[!template id=filecontent name="/etc/usbhidaction.conf" text=""" |
|
Consumer:Consumer_Control.Consumer:Volume_Up 1 |
|
mixerctl -n -w outputs.master++ |
|
Consumer:Consumer_Control.Consumer:Volume_Down 1 |
|
mixerctl -n -w outputs.master-- |
|
Consumer:Consumer_Control.Consumer:Mute 1 |
|
mixerctl -n -w outputs.mute++ |
|
Consumer:Consumer_Control.Consumer:AC_Home 1 |
|
/etc/powerd/scripts/hotkey_button AC_Home pressed |
|
Generic_Desktop:System_Control.Generic_Desktop:System_Sleep 1 |
|
/etc/powerd/scripts/sleep_button System_Sleep pressed |
|
"""]] |
|
|
|
Then start two copies of usbhidaction: |
|
|
|
[[!template id=programlisting text=""" |
|
# /usr/bin/usbhidaction -c /etc/usbhidaction.conf -f /dev/uhid0 -i -p /var/run/usbhidaction-uhid0.pid |
|
# /usr/bin/usbhidaction -c /etc/usbhidaction.conf -f /dev/uhid1 -i -p /var/run/usbhidaction-uhid1.pid |
|
"""]] |

## Pinebook keyboard |
|
|
|
The new 11" 1080p model has a slightly different keyboard layout to the 14". |
|
Using wscons it works perfectly, but using X the \ key next to left shift will display > when pressed. |
|
To solve this, you need to change the keyboard layout to altgr-intl. This can be done system wide by creating the file: |
|
|
|
[[!template id=filecontent name="/etc/X11/xorg.conf.d/00-system-keyboard.conf" text=""" |
|
Section "InputDevice" |
|
Identifier "Pinebook 1080p keyboard" |
|
Driver "kbd" |
|
Option "XkbLayout" "us" |
|
Option "XkbVariant" "altgr-intl" |
|
EndSection |
|
"""]] |

## Pinebook touchpad |
|
|
|
To fix jittery touch input on the touchpad, you can adjust the input sensitivity by creating the file: |
|
|
|
[[!template id=filecontent name="/etc/X11/xorg.conf.d/00-system-touchpad.conf" text=""" |
|
Section "InputDevice" |
|
Identifier "Pinebook touchpad" |
|
Driver "mouse" |
|
Option "AccelerationProfile" "2" |
|
Option "AdaptiveDeceleration" "1" |
|
Option "ConstantDeceleration" "2.4" # Pinebook 14" |
|
#Option "ConstantDeceleration" "1.2" # Pinebook 11" |
|
EndSection |
|
"""]] |

## Pinebook screen |
|
|
|
X11 currently cannot work out the size of the screen, resulting in a very small DPI on a very small screen. |
|
This file configures X to use an 11.6" screen, which results in very readable a DPI of 190. |
|
|
|
[[!template id=filecontent name="/etc/X11/xorg.conf.d/01-pinebook-11-screen.conf" text=""" |
|
Section "Monitor" |
|
Identifier "Pinebook 11.6 inch monitor" |
|
DisplaySize 256.8 144.5 # millimeters, 11.6 inch screen |
|
EndSection |
|
|
|
Section "Screen" |
|
Identifier "Default Screen" |
|
Monitor "Pinebook 11.6 inch monitor" |
|
EndSection |
|
"""]] |
